Minister of Power, Abubakar Aliyu said the Federal Government was willing to partner with investors in the electricity sector to boost the country’s electricity supply.

Mathew Osumanyi Dan’asabe, Information, Press and Public Relations Officer, Ministry of Power, said in a statement.

Aliyu made the announcement while accepting Turkey’s ambassador to Nigeria, Mr.

Mr Hidayet Bayratar, in company of two other delegates in office in Abuja.
He said that President Muhammadu Buhari’s desire towards the power sector was to ensure that the electricity supply industry is owned by both government and the private sectors.

According to him, the relationship between Nigeria and Turkey is a longstanding relationship that led to the signing of a Memorandum of Understanding (MoU) between Turkey and Nigeria in October 2021 for mutual benefit. Aliyu told the ambassador that various interventions were being incorporated into the country’s electricity sector. He described the distribution aspect of the country’s electricity sector as an area worth investing in.

The minister urged Turkey and the rest of the world to partner with Nigeria and share experiences in the fields of energy, renewable energy and energy efficiency. In his response, the Ambassador said their visit was a follow-up to the MoU signed in 2021. (NAN)
